Age Limit & Selection Process - Age Limit: Minimum 18 years and Maximum 22 years (Male), Maximum 25 year.
- Age Relaxation: 05 years for SC/ST, 03 years for OBC, as per government norms
- Selection Process: Written Examination → Document Verification → Physical Measurements Test (PST) → Physical Efficiency Test (PET) → Medical Examination

| Post Name | Total Vacancies | Eligibility |
| Police Constable (Male) | NA | - 12th Class (Intermediate) pass from recognized board
- Height: Minimum 168 cm (General), 160 cm (Reserved categories)
- Chest: 79 cm (without expansion), 84 cm (with expansion)
- Age: 18-22 years
|
| Police Constable (Female) | NA | - 12th Class (Intermediate) pass from recognized board
- Height: Minimum 152 cm (General), 147 cm (Reserved categories)
- Weight: Proportionate to height and age
- Age: 18-25 years

Salary & Pay Scale Details - Pay Scale: Level 3 – ₹21,700 – 69,100/- (7th Pay Commission)
- Pay Band: ₹5,200 – 20,200/- with Grade Pay ₹2,000/-
- In-Hand Salary: ₹25,000 – 35,000/- (including allowances)
- Additional Benefits: DA, HRA, Medical, Travel Allowance, Ration Money, Dress Allowance
- Job Security: State Government Employee Benefits with Pension Scheme
- Career Growth: Head Constable → ASI → Sub Inspector → Inspector → Higher Ranks
- Annual Increment: 3% per year as per 7th Pay Commission
